" If you're constructing in a mature neighborhood, you're just constructing new building and construction for yourself. That's going to be custom-made, and it's going to set you back more." A spec home is one that has actually been finished by a home builder and is all set for move-in. It's still a brand-new home, and you'll still be the first to live there you just won't have actually been part of the layout procedure or had input on the materials used.


A custom-made home is simply that a totally customized building.


They're representing the home builder, and it's their work to get the contractor leading dollar and under the finest problems." An experienced purchaser's representative, on the other hand, will be functioning with your ideal interests in mind. Representatives that are familiar with new building homes will certainly understand any type of quirks or anomalies that might emerge with agreements, also.


" As an example, if you acquire [an existing] house right here in Charleston, there's a South Carolina state-approved contract that you use, and you simply fill up in the information. A building contractor is going to create their very own contract; they're more than most likely not going to approve a boilerplate agreement." A great customer's representative will certainly be able to assess these contracts with you and make certain you're not validating terms that profit just the building contractor and leave you possibly actually out in the cold.

Though several lenders can most likely supply some this contact form kind of appropriate car loan whether via a financing network or their own indicates it's best to collaborate with a loan provider who is acquainted with the new building procedure. You can ask your property agent for a referral, or try searching online for "brand-new building home lending [city, state] to begin.


When the building is completed, the car loan will certainly either be exchanged a regular home loan, or your building and construction lender will certainly need you to obtain a separate home loan. Not all lenders use this kind of lending. Building contractors read review normally have a listing of suggested lending institutions and might even attract you to make use of one of those lending institutions by minimizing the rate.




You might also encounter something called a bridge financing. These are usually used by investors who are acting swiftly to buy land for growth, however they can also be utilized by individuals who understand they will certainly be constructing a home in the future to "bridge" the void in between your previous home and your brand-new home.
